

My Friend Pedro is a side-scrolling action shooter where you follow orders from a talking banana. You're gunning down enemies across urban and industrial environments, chaining kills through slow-motion sequences and acrobatic moves. The game emphasizes stylish combat: you can split-aim at two targets simultaneously, ricochet bullets off frying pans and signs, and perform flips while unloading dual weapons. Each level scores your performance based on speed and creativity. The banana—Pedro—offers commentary between firefights, framing your rampage through a surreal lens that never takes itself seriously. Expect physics-driven shootouts where motorcycles, skateboards, and zip lines become part of your arsenal. It's built for players who want to replay sections until they nail a perfect run.
